10.10.07 - It's over, I finished it! For those who aren't aware, last Friday I participated in the annual Greek IV Golf Marathon - 100 holes of golf in just over 10 hours. It was exhausting to say the least as the temperature in Indianapolis was over 90 for much of the day. All in all it was a tremendous experience, and I'm proud to say that I completed all 100 holes, took about 560 swings, and emerged with no major blisters – just muscle pain on my left arm and my neck! Given that we raised over $26,000 for Greek Conference it was well worth the minor discomforts. That money lowers overhead costs from the hotel and keeps the price we have to charge students lower. For the Greensboro Conference (the one that I am the local director for), we are able to offer a Conference rate that is lower than last years rate! Praise God!
